If you are an amateur radio enthusiast deeply involved in digital modes—specifically FT8, FT4, and JT9—you have likely come across the name JTDX . Known for its superior decoding sensitivity and optimized performance on low-signal paths, JTDX has become a favorite alternative to WSJT-X.
